Fine-dining Stone restaurant rebranding to create 'luxury guest experience'
By Liana Snape 15th Apr 2026
A fine-dining restaurant in Stone, which has been recognised in the Michelin guide, has announced that it will be rebranding and offering an exciting new menu.
Little Seeds, which will now be named Little Seeds by Jake Lowndes, will be solely offering a tasting menu from 14 May.
Owners Jake and Sophie Lowndes announced that they will be dropping the a la carte menu to allow them to "hone in on a more luxury guest experience".
Sophie said: "We are focusing just on our tasting menu to create a quality and luxury experience.
"It will allow us to dive into our foraging and growing unusual herbs that we will blend with the best produce we can get in the country.
"That is still the core ethos of our food."

Chef Patron, Jake Lowndes, will be creating four completely different seasonal menus every year.
The first will be the spring menu which will begin when the restaurant reopens on 14 May until 11 July.
The interior of the restaurant will also receive a makeover with seating reduced to make space for a new lounge area where guests will be able to have a drink before their meal.
This means that the seating will be reduced to 16, emphasising the "exclusivity" of the experience.
Sophie added: "The new lounge and the limited seating will create a quality experience for guests."
